Founded in 2002, Radio-Coteau is committed to regenerative agriculture and the philosophy that “the best fertilizer is the farmer’s shadow.” The farmer in this case is owner Eric Sussman, who bottles wine sourced from both his own estate in Sebastopol and surrounding organic vineyards. In the case of Savoy, these Pinot Noir grapes come from the adjacent Anderson Valley in the Mendocino AVA with a climate reminiscent of Burgundy. This Pinot is bright with pomegranate and black cherry notes, a warming white pepper nose and a delicate finish. It would accompany herb-roasted poultry harmoniously.
